Justrite 7120110 Type 1 safety can is suitable for storing 2 gallons of flammable liquids like gasoline. It can also be used for filling, transporting & pouring stored liquids in oil & gas, chemical, automotive and maintenance & repair applications.
Features:
- Justrite 7120110 Type 1 safety can is equipped with a self-closing gasketed lid that is spring-loaded to close automatically after filling / pouring, thereby preventing vapours from exiting or stored fluids from spilling.
- This lid further features a positive pressure relief mechanism to vent vapours in case of a fire to prevent rupture / explosion.
- It has a stainless steel flame arrester integrated within the fill / pour spout to stop any external heat source from igniting during pouring or filling.
- This safety can's swinging handle pulls back to open the lid and allows easy carrying of the unit.
- It comes with a polypropylene funnel having two positions. The funnel stays up when pouring & folds down when filling the can.
- This Justrite 7120110 Type 1 safety can has a yellow coloured band with a large content identification area for a warning against potential dangers, indicating the designated department or individual users and avoiding misuse or mixing of incompatible liquids.
- It is red colour coded to signal the storage of gasoline and prevent any accident & cross-contamination.

Q. What is the difference between a Type 1 and a Type 2 safety can?
A. Type I safety cans feature a single opening to fill or dispense fluids and Type II safety cans have two separate openings, one to pour precisely & one with an ergonomic lift-lever to fill easily.
